Output 89443018c741b9cb9d14688e517b147415823a92b594001ac30e49f02ee389ba:0

value
512599979
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23f56fabf15b41738fbe2fb6716e76059e09004b OP_EQUALVERIFY OP_CHECKSIG
address
14H8fvSdUY2F9r2NexmyjUVufudPFFHTH6
transaction
89443018c741b9cb9d14688e517b147415823a92b594001ac30e49f02ee389ba
spent
true